What Could an Analogy for the Cytoskeleton of a Cell Be?

The cytoskeleton is a dynamic network of protein filaments and tubules that provides structural support and organization to eukaryotic cells. It's responsible for maintaining cell shape, facilitating intracellular transport, and participating in cell division.

One common analogy for the cytoskeleton is a scaffolding. Just as scaffolding provides a framework for a building, the cytoskeleton creates a structural framework for the cell. It gives the cell its shape and ensures that the cell's organelles and other components are properly positioned and organized.

Another analogy for the cytoskeleton is a transportation system. The cytoskeleton's filaments and tubules form tracks and highways that allow organelles, proteins, and other molecules to move within the cell. They act as a transportation network that facilitates the movement of materials throughout the cell.

Additionally, the cytoskeleton is often likened to a muscle. Like muscles, the cytoskeleton can contract and relax to generate force. This force is used for a variety of cellular processes, including cell division, cell migration, and changes in cell shape.
